抄録

Zonal flows are now widely recognized to be a key phenomenon for understanding of fluctuation-induced transport in magnetically confined plasmas. The existence of the zonal flows has been directly identified by the measurement of electric-field fluctuations as well as of bicoherence of drift-wave turbulence which introduces the energy transfer from drift waves to zonal flows via three-wave interactions. The appropriate diagnostic methods for these subjects are introduced.
